1

Batch Processing Jobs in Minnesota (NOW HIRING)

PeopleSoft Batch Lead Location: St. Paul, MN Duration: 6+ months Client: Direct Client Roles and ... Provide business process design, configuration and documentation for any new 9.2 functionality; Act ...

Software Engineer

Minneapolis, MN · Hybrid

$53 - $57/hr

You will work primarily with COBOL, VSAM, and JCL , supporting batch-heavy processing and ensuring the reliable movement of financial data across integrated systems. Success in this role requires ...

... and batch processing knowledge. • EngageOne interactive Data records creation, setting record patterns, template development, doc1gen, doc1pce, content author • PowerShell scripting • ...

Batch processes labels in various label software along with FedEx Ship Manager, UPS WorldShip and ERP software programs. * Processes, releases and manages outbound sales orders in Microsoft Dynamics ...

Batch processes labels in various label software along with FedEx Ship Manager, UPS WorldShip and ERP software programs. * Processes, releases and manages outbound sales orders in Microsoft Dynamics ...

next page

Showing results 1-20

Batch Processing information

See Minnesota salary details

$12

$19

$32

How much do batch processing jobs pay per hour?

As of May 31, 2026, the average hourly pay for batch processing in Minnesota is $19.92, according to ZipRecruiter salary data. Most workers in this role earn between $16.97 and $20.72 per hour, depending on experience, location, and employer.

What is a Batch Processing job?

A Batch Processing job is a type of computing task that processes large volumes of data in groups (or batches) without user interaction. These jobs are typically scheduled to run at specific times or triggered by certain conditions. Batch processing is commonly used for tasks such as payroll processing, data transformation, and report generation. It is efficient for handling repetitive, high-volume data operations while optimizing system resources.

What are the key skills and qualifications needed to thrive in the Batch Processing position, and why are they important?

To excel in a Batch Processing role, strong analytical skills, attention to detail, and experience with data processing or IT systems are essential, often supported by a degree in computer science or a related field. Familiarity with scheduling tools (like Control-M or AutoSys), mainframe environments, scripting languages, and database management is typically required. Effective communication, time management, and problem-solving abilities help professionals in this role interface with multiple teams and handle workflow interruptions. These skills ensure smooth, efficient, and accurate processing of high-volume data or transactions, minimizing errors and downtime.

What are the typical daily responsibilities for someone working in Batch Processing?

Professionals in Batch Processing are usually responsible for scheduling, monitoring, and troubleshooting large-scale data or transaction jobs that run in batches, often outside of normal business hours. They ensure that jobs are executed on time, errors are identified and resolved promptly, and all data processing meets organizational standards for accuracy and security. Collaboration with IT, database administrators, and business analysts is common to update or optimize batch processes. Additionally, they may generate reports and maintain logs for compliance or auditing purposes. The role requires keen attention to detail and flexibility to respond quickly to issues or changing workloads.

What jobs make $3,000 a month without a degree?

Jobs related to batch processing, such as data entry, warehouse work, or certain manufacturing roles, can sometimes pay around $3,000 monthly without requiring a degree. These positions often focus on skills like attention to detail, basic technical knowledge, or physical work, and may involve shift work or on-the-job training.
What are popular job titles related to Batch Processing jobs in Minnesota? For Batch Processing jobs in Minnesota, the most frequently searched job titles are:
What cities in Minnesota are hiring for Batch Processing jobs? Cities in Minnesota with the most Batch Processing job openings:
Infographic showing various Batch Processing job openings in Minnesota as of May 2026, with employment types broken down into 78% Full Time, 17% Part Time, 3% Temporary, and 2% Contract. Highlights an 71% Physical, 24% Hybrid, and 5% Remote job distribution, with an average salary of $41,433 per year, or $19.9 per hour.

Data Portfolio Manager

Purple Drive Technologies

Minneapolis, MN • On-site

Full-time

Posted 16 days ago


Job description

Overview:
Job Title: Data Portfolio Manager
Location: Minneapolis, MN (Onsite)
Experience: 10+ Years
Role Summary
Lead enterprise data initiatives including cloud migration, data modernization, and AI enablement. Own roadmap, delivery, and stakeholder alignment across large-scale data programs.
Key Responsibilities
  • Drive data transformation programs (migration, MDM, AI scaling)
  • Lead ETL / batch processing / data orchestration teams
  • Modernize legacy Oracle/SQL platforms to cloud (ADF, Databricks, Snowflake)
  • Ensure SLA, performance, and operational excellence
  • Manage cross-functional teams and stakeholders
  • Implement automation, monitoring, and AI-assisted development
Required Skills
  • Strong experience with SQL, Oracle, Informatica, CDC
  • Hands-on with ADF, Synapse, Databricks, Snowflake
  • Experience in data platform modernization & cloud migration
  • Proven leadership of large data engineering teams
  • Strong knowledge of ETL frameworks and batch processing
Nice to Have
  • Insurance / Financial domain
  • AI/ML or modern data architecture exposure